About Texhoma, OK
Texhoma, Oklahoma, is a small, unique city located in the Panhandle region of the state. It is part of Texas County and serves as a centerpiece for the surrounding agricultural community. Known for its friendly atmosphere and rural charm, Texhoma captures the essence of small-town life in Oklahoma.
Location & geography
Texhoma is situated in the northwestern part of Oklahoma, bordered by Texas on its southern edge, with the nearest cities being Guymon approximately 30 miles to the southwest and Beaver around 35 miles to the northwest. The city covers a vast land area of 452.20 square miles, complemented by a small water area of 1.99 square miles. The terrain consists primarily of flat plains, typical of the Oklahoma Panhandle region, making it ideal for agriculture.
Community & economy
The character of Texhoma is defined by its strong sense of community and the agricultural lifestyle that predominates in the area. The economy is centered around farming and ranching, with residents frequently participating in local livestock shows and agricultural fairs. Daily life in Texhoma reflects the values of neighborly cooperation and rural traditions, offering a close-knit environment for families and visitors alike.
Transportation
Transportation in and out of Texhoma is facilitated by U.S. Highway 54 and State Highway 287, which provide access to surrounding areas. The nearest commercial airport is located in Guymon, while residents often rely on personal vehicles for travel within the region. Public transit options are limited due to the city's small size.
History
Texhoma was founded at the junction of the Texas and Oklahoma state lines, highlighting its unique geographical position. Historically, the city developed as a trading post and a hub for the agricultural industry, which continues to dominate the local economy. Notable events in Texhoma's history include the establishment of various community organizations that promote local culture and support economic development.
